温馨提示×

zookeeper配置文件如何进行调试

小樊
81
2024-12-27 01:32:04
栏目: 大数据

Zookeeper配置文件的调试是一个重要的过程,它可以帮助您确保Zookeeper集群的稳定运行。以下是一些关于如何进行Zookeeper配置文件调试的详细步骤和注意事项:

Zookeeper配置文件调试步骤

  • 修改配置文件:根据您的集群环境和需求,修改zoo.cfg文件中的关键参数,如dataDir(数据存储目录)、clientPort(客户端连接端口)、tickTime(心跳间隔时间)等。
  • 启动Zookeeper服务:在命令行中,导航到Zookeeper的主目录,然后运行./bin/zkServer.sh start启动Zookeeper服务。
  • 检查服务状态:使用命令./bin/zkServer.sh status检查Zookeeper服务是否正常运行。
  • 查看日志文件:检查Zookeeper的日志文件,通常位于/zookeeper/logs目录下,查找错误信息或异常行为。

常见问题及解决方法

  • 无法启动Zookeeper服务:检查zoo.cfg文件中的路径是否正确,确保所有依赖服务(如Java环境)已正确安装并启动。同时,查看Zookeeper的日志文件,通常位于/zookeeper/zkdata/logs目录下,以获取详细的错误信息。
  • 客户端连接失败:确保zoo.cfg文件中的clientPort配置正确,并且防火墙允许该端口的通信。可以使用telnet命令测试端口是否开放。
  • 数据目录权限问题:确保数据目录具有正确的读写权限。可以使用sudo chown -R your_user:your_group /zookeeper/zkdatasudo chmod -R 755 /zookeeper/zkdata命令更改目录权限。

通过上述步骤,您可以有效地调试Zookeeper配置文件,确保Zookeeper集群的稳定运行。如果遇到具体问题,建议查阅Zookeeper的官方文档或寻求社区的帮助。

0